Montgomery confirmed to lead FHA

Montgomery confirmationThe Senate on Wednesday confirmed the nomination of Brian Montgomery to lead the Federal Housing Administration (FHA); this will be his second time as FHA commissioner. NAFCU will send a letter to Montgomery today congratulating him on his new role.

Montgomery previously held the job under President George W. Bush and stayed on for six months when President Barack Obama took office.

NAFCU has long recognized and supported FHA's important role in the housing finance market. The association is also urging Congress, as discussions of housing finance reform are underway, to preserve credit unions' equal access to the secondary mortgage market and for fair pricing based on loan quality rather than volume.
